We have been keen to pimp our entry path. We inherited a pretty pathetic set of stepping stones which have always been awkward to use and not so impressive to look at.

With our extensions to start in the New Year (sometime!) we wanted to ensure that our front door is still obvious, as the extension will protrude from one side of the house, making our front garden almost a courtyard and it would be good to direct the eye towards our entry.

We bought the same pavers that we recently paved our laundry courtyard with - they are beautiful and a really soft colour that matches the house trim. And we bought the same trimming blocks in dark charcoal. I am not usually a matchy matchy person but the two areas are on different sides of the house and I think it offers some continuity in theme...

And so in the stinking heat and heavy humidity (paving in Summer is always the best time lol), poor old Jase slaved away, whilst I supervised (site foreman) and Elka enjoyed her toddler pool in the shade of the verandah (tough life of the toddler). But my impressive hubby knocked over the whole job in the one morning!
